Skoda India has introduced two new limited-run colour options with the Slavia Monte Carlo Edition. The Czech carmaker says that only 200 units of the Slavia Monte Carlo will be produced in these colour options. Despite these exclusive new colours, prices remain unchanged, ranging from Rs 16.69 lakh to Rs 18.19 lakh.

Skoda Slavia Monte Carlo limited-run colour details
Dubbed Shimla Green and Steel Grey, both new paint options feature a black roof
The two limited-run colour options on the Slavia Monte Carlo Edition are called Shimla Green and Steel Grey. Both have a dual-tone finish, with the roof finished in black. This increases the colour palette available for the Slavia to seven options, albeit for a limited time. The Slavia Monte Carlo is already offered in two monotone colours, namely Lava Blue and Deep Black, alongside three dual-tone shades with a black roof: Candy White, Brilliant Silver and Cherry Red.
Based on the top-end Prestige trim, the Monte Carlo edition sits at the top of the Slavia line-up. It brings several cosmetic upgrades, some of which are also shared with the mid-level Sportline trim. For the exterior, these include dual-tone paint options, a blacked-out finish for the grille, bumper elements, logos, outside rearview mirrors and 16-inch alloy wheels, Monte Carlo branding on the front fenders, a smoked effect for the tail-lamps and a black boot-lip spoiler.
On the inside, you get an all-black layout with red accents, a red theme for the digital driver’s display, red-and-black leatherette seats with Monte Carlo inscriptions, Monte Carlo-branded scuff plates, red stitching for the front door armrests and sporty metal pedals.
Skoda Slavia Monte Carlo engine and gearbox options
Two engines on offer with automatic gearboxes only
The Monte Carlo Edition is offered with two direct-injection turbo-petrol engine options. There’s a 1.0-litre unit that develops 115hp and 178Nm of torque, paired with a 6-speed torque-converter automatic. The larger, more powerful 1.5-litre mill churns out 150hp and 250Nm of torque and is mated to a 7-speed DCT.
